Kobo Resources Announces Significant Drill Results at Kossou Gold Project

Kobo Resources Inc., the growth-focused gold exploration company based in Côte d'Ivoire, has announced significant drill results that continue to expand the known mineralisation at its 100%-owned Kossou Gold Project. The findings, obtained from seven additional diamond drill holes, highlight the presence of high-grade gold mineralisation both within and adjacent to the Main Road Cut Shear, extending the mineralised system to the north and at depth.
The latest drilling, which has now extended over 51,295 meters, is part of an ongoing two-drill program aimed at advancing resource definition and exploration. The program is expected to culminate in the issuance of an inaugural Mineral Resource Estimate (MRE) in the fourth quarter of 2026.
Key findings from the recent drilling include: - KDD0179 returned a 1.0-meter interval at 68.60 grams per tonne (g/t) gold, along with two other intervals of 5.0 meters at 4.55 g/t and 5.0 meters at 4.01 g/t gold. - KDD0175, another significant hole, found 4.0 meters at 0.58 g/t gold along the Contact Zone Fault, indicating the mineralisation extends beyond the principal shear structures. - Additional high-grade intervals were noted, including 2.0 meters at 7.75 g/t gold and 4.0 meters at 2.50 g/t gold.
These results confirm the presence of gold mineralisation hosted in foliated and sheared basalts, associated with vein sets within the principal shear zones. Notably, gold mineralisation has also been observed in unfoliated basalt host rocks and volcanosedimentary rocks along the Contact Zone Fault.
